Overcoming Manual Costing
and Pricing Delays

In many research offices the spreadsheet is the costing tool and the grants system only records the result. Staff time, non-staff costs, overheads and the recoverable amount are calculated manually, then keyed into the grants management system again. Principal Investigator time inputs do not flow into the costing module, so the costs are calculated again, printed and sent back. Every change creates another version, and the funder recovery rule is still selected manually for each line. That costs time, because the same figures are recalculated at every stage, and accuracy, because every transfer out of a spreadsheet is another chance to key a number wrong.
GrantsNow calculates the costing inside the grants process. Staff costs, overheads and funder recovery rates are applied by predefined rules as the data is entered. Costing models are reusable, so a full economic costing template or a 25 percent EU overhead model is loaded rather than rebuilt. A revision copies the existing version and updates only what changed. Funder rules are configured once, applied repeatedly and uploaded in bulk. Spreadsheets can still be used to check a figure. What goes is the need to recreate the same costing several times before submission.
